It's a tough job, isn't it? I love the look, but I don't know if I'll do it again. The China red silk looked fabulous, but it was really hard to get it right.

I put my silk on very wet and pulled hard too, trying not to distort. Sometimes I put thinner on, took it all off, and re-did it. My biggest mistake was not putting on enough coats. After awhile oil leaked through and made the covering splotchy.

I modified my 4 Star also, going for a little classier look, at least that's what I thought. Yours has a good 1930s looks to it. I'd go with Golden Age wheels instead of WWI type. It's looking really nice. The diagonals in the wing are an excellent idea. I hate it when wings warp after a few years, and that should prevent it. Sig does that on the 4 Star 60.
